
Noah R. Friend
After completing law school, he spent over three years working for the United States Magistrate Judge in Ashland and Pikeville.
Mr. Friend has been in private practice since January, 2011. His practice has focused on bankruptcy, appellate practice, and federal criminal and civil litigation, including consumer rights issues, and constitutional law. He has participated in cases filed before the United States Court of Appeals for the Sixth Circuit, the Kentucky Court of Appeals,and the Kentucky Supreme Court.
His bankruptcy practice includes extensive litigation involving automatic stay violations, discharge violations, and preferential transfers.Areas of Practice
